Efficiency and Timing of Voice Commands
You know what's great? Having everything you need right at your fingertips. Whether you're on the payload, defending the intelligence, or healing your team as the stalwart Medic, the efficiency and timing of your voice commands can dramatically affect the outcome of a match. Imagine this—you see the opposition’s Spy lurking near the Engineer's sentry setup. Rather than typing furiously into chat, potentially missing the opportunity, you tap a key and send out a quick "Spy!" alert. Not only is this faster than typing, it also leaves your hands free to perform your role effectively.

Integration of Voice Communication with Text and Visuals
Voice commands are just one part of the rich tapestry of communication in Team Fortress 2. Integrating them with text chat and visual cues can take your team's coordination to a whole new level. Imagine you're a Scout, zipping around gathering intel; you use the voice command for "Sentry ahead," but also type more specific details in chat, such as "Sentry at point B, right corner." This way, any team members who missed the initial call can catch up via text, ensuring everyone is on the same page.
Moreover, don’t underestimate the power of visual cues—like a character's animations or the direction they're facing. These can often complement your voice commands. Say you're navigating a particularly tricky map such as Dustbowl; using the combination of visual signals and a "Follow me!" voice command can be a highly effective way to direct your team through the most optimal path.
